Meet Ch DOZMARE DISTINCTIVE "Sam"
Sam----Ch DOZMARE DISTINCTIVE. 18 C.Cs. Group Winner. Best Of Breed at Crufts 1996/98. Best In Show U.K. Griffon Club Championship Show 18/4/98. Plus many other awards.
THE OUBOROUGH CHALLENGE CUP
Awarded by the Kennel Club of England for the Best of Breed Griffon. Present holder Leorin Griffon's Ch: Dozmare Distinctive.
It stands 2 feet 3 inches high (27 inches) and is in solid Hallmarked silver. The list of winners 1969 till 1998 has been previously published on Griffy-L.
